Dragons Breath Custard v2
*N.E.T. Style (AS,FY!)


% of everything listed should vary according to taste and type of flavoring used:
3- 5% tobacco(s).
3% Fruit(s) that must include at least 1.5% dragon fruit;)
2% Custard(s)
1.75% Vanilla Bean Ice Cream(s) - AKA VBIC
.75% Cake(s)
.75% Vanilla Cream(s)


My specific formula:
ASRNET* @ 5%
VBIC (Purilium) @ .5%
VBIC (TFA) @ .5%
VBIC (FW) @ .25%
French Vanilla (TFA) @ .25%
Vanilla Bourbon w/ Cream (Purilium) @ .5%
Cake Batter (Cappella) @ .25%
Candy Cake (Purilium) @ .5%
Vanilla Custard v1 (Cappella) @ .75%
Vanilla Custard v2 (Cappella) @ .75%
Custard (Inawera) @ .5%
Dragon Fruit (TFA) @ 1.75%
Boysenberry Preserves (Purilium) @ .5%
Raspberry (Purilium) @ .75%

I measure for 30ml and my preferred:
5mg/ml Nic - 1.5 mL @ 5%
20ish % PG (21.85% in this case)
80ish % VG (78.15% in this case)
Instavape is great with a healthy tobacco flavor to begin, fruit through middle and leading to the custard that ends nicely. The flavors have flip flopped a bit through out the taste tests (6ml). Very good cream custard. Fruits are subtle but could shine later in life. I've got another 30 ml steeping.

*For tobacco flavor in my the v2:
American Spirit Regular (light blue package) NET. Processed flavoring via 7 week pg soak and quick filter. My first attempt at NET that has left me wanting more:)....
V1 I used a random tobacco flavoring and while ok wasn't anything special. I think the juice suffered cuz of it.
